PURPOSE: An artificial protein translational fusion partner comprising the combination of pre-secretion signal and pro-secretion signal for producing and secreting foreign protein is provided to mass-produce foreign protein hardly mass-produced in yeast due to a traditional recombinant technique with hGH. CONSTITUTION: An artificial protein translational fusion partner for producing and secreting foreign protein comprises the pre-secreting signal and pro-secretion signal of protein translational fusion partner from yeast. The pre-secretion signal and pro-secretion signal are picked from different protein translational fusion partners. Pre-secretion signal is the protein in the sequence number from 1 (SEQ ID NO:1) to 25 (SEQ ID NO:25) the sequence number from 51 (SEQ ID NO:51) to 75 (SEQ ID NO:75. Pro-secretion signal is the protein chosen in the sequence number from 1 (SEQ ID NO:1) to 25 (SEQ ID NO:25 or the gene chosen in the sequence number from 51 (SEQ ID NO:51) to 75(SEQ ID NO:75). The foreign protein is human growth hormone and pre-secretion signal is TFP 20-pre(the sequence number 14 and 64) and pro-secretion signal is TFP3-pre(the sequence number 3 and 53) or TFP 3-pre(the sequence number 10 and 60). A method of producing foreign protein comprises the following steps. An expression vector with an artificial protein translational fusion factor and a foreign protein gene to be produced is made(i). The expression vector in step (i) is introduced in yeast so that a transformant is produced(ii). The transformant is cultivated and foreign protein is obtained in a culture or a supernatant layer(iii).
